Container Plant Sizes
Container sizes indicate plant age and growing capacity rather than liquid volume equivalents. Our containers follow industry-standard nursery "trade gallon" specifications, which differ from standard liquid gallon measurements.
Young Plants (6 months to 18 months old)
Container Size | Actual Volume | Metric Equivalent |
---|---|---|
2" x 2" x 3" | 0.18 - 0.21 dry quarts | 0.20 - 0.23 dry liters |
4" Container | 0.31 - 0.87 dry quarts | 0.35 - 0.96 dry liters |
4.5" Container | 0.65 dry quarts | 0.72 dry liters |
6" Container | 1.4 dry quarts | 1.59 dry liters |
1 Quart | 1 dry quart | 1.1 dry liters |
5.5" Container | 1.89 dry quarts | 2.08 dry liters |

Big fluttering petals, the creamy white petals of Callies Memory Peony (Paeonia 'Callies Memory') are tinged in lavender-pink edges and accented with bright magenta-red feathered spots at the base of each! Pollinators will feel upstaged by these glorious blooms! Nearly double, the large blooms are each crowned with a golden ring of anthers in the centers of each!
Fast-growing in green leafy mounds of foliage that highlight the amazing flowers and then look great as fillers and background foliage for the remainder of the growing season! Amazingly fragrant and eye-catching blooms for the floral bouquet, when you snip the blossoms just as the buds start to show color, giving you a long-lasting display!
Callies Memory Peony plants live for up to 50 years and Itoh Peonies were created by cross-breeding herbaceous Peonies with Tree Peonies, creating these fantastic new hybrids! Hardy throughout USDA growing zones 3 through 8, these ornamental flowering rhizomes have thick, fleshy roots with several 'eyes' each.

#ProPlantTips for Care:
Itoh Peony rhizomes have the strongest stems in full sun and grow best away from trees and shrubs, as competition for nutrients and moisture inhibits their growth. Plant in an enriched, well-drained environment. It is pretty low maintenance and prefers average moisture, in a decently sheltered environment for optimum growth, that also has good air circulation.
The enormous blooms may need staking to help support the stems against storms and the driving summer rain. Put down a 3-4 inch layer of arborist mulch chips around the base of your plant to hold in more moisture. For continued healthy growth, Deadhead the faded flowers and wait to trim down the foliage as the leaves begin to fade in the fall.

Information About Bareroot Peonies
Bareroot Peonies are shipped as nice, 3-5 eye bareroot divisions. Their woody roots are not uniform, it is normal for each root to look slightly different.
Nature Hills Nursery ships bare-root Peonies in the fall according to your growing zone to ensure they will remain dormant all winter until emerging in spring.
